§ 45-1-81.38 — Transaction Fee - Certain Transactions

Effective September 1, 2003, a special transaction fee of two dollars ($2) shall be paid to and collected by the judge of probate on any transaction, at the discretion of the judge of probate, occurring in, or under the jurisdiction of the judge of probate with the exception of drivers’ licenses and motor vehicle registration. This amount shall be in addition to all other costs and fees heretofore collected. Any, all, or none of the special transaction fees collected shall be paid into the special fund of the judge of probate created in Section 45-1-81.36.

Legislative History
(Act 2003-202, p. 523, §9.)
